A city engineer claims that the average wait time at a certain traffic light is less than 45 seconds. To test this claim, an auditor collects random wait time data for the traffic light and conducts a hypothesis test at significance level 0.05. A summary of the test is below. Ho: H 2 45 H1: < 45 (claim) n = 28 X = 41 S = 17 P = 0.1119 Fail to reject Ho Using the results of the hypothesis test, choose the correct interpretation regarding the engineer's claim. The data indicate that the average wait time at the traffic light is significantly lower than 45 seconds. The engineer is likely correct. The data indicate that the average wait time at the traffic light is lower than 45 seconds, but the sample size is not large enough to draw a conclusion. We do not know whether the engineer is correct. The data indicate that the average wait time at the traffic light is lower than 45 seconds, but not significantly so. We do not know whether the engineer is correct. The data indicate that the average wait time at the traffic light is in fact higher than 45 seconds. The engineer is likely incorrect
